[WebAssembly] Emit clangast in custom section aligned by 4 bytes

Emit __clangast in custom section instead of named data segment
to find it while iterating sections.
This could be avoided if all data segements (the wasm sense) were
represented as their own sections (in the llvm sense).
This can be resolved by https://github.com/WebAssembly/tool-conventions/issues/138

And the on-disk hashtable in clangast needs to be aligned by 4 bytes,
so add paddings in name length field in custom section header.

The length of clangast section name can be represented in 1 byte
by leb128, and possible maximum pads are 3 bytes, so the section
name length won't be invalid in theory.
